Allan Leinwand, CTO of ServiceNow, has joined the Vendor Forum on DEVOPSdigest.

Leinwand is responsible for overseeing all technical aspects and guiding the long-term technology strategy for ServiceNow. Prior to joining ServiceNow, he was CTO – Infrastructure at Zynga, Inc., where he oversaw the company’s infrastructure technology. Throughout his executive career, Leinwand was a venture partner for Panorama Capital, an operating partner for JPMorgan Partners, and founder of Vyatta, an open-source networking company, acquired by Brocade. He was co-founder and president of Proficient Networks and was VP of Engineering and CTO for Digital Island, from inception and through its IPO and secondary offering. Leinwand was also an early employee of Cisco Systems, Inc. and performed both individual contributor and managerial roles for the company. Leinwand currently holds a bachelor of science degree in computer science from the University of Colorado at Boulder. In the past he was an adjunct professor at the University of California, Berkeley.

ServiceNow helps the modern enterprise operate faster and be more scalable than ever before. Customers use the company's service model to define, structure and automate the flow of work, removing dependencies on email and spreadsheets to transform the delivery and management of services for the enterprise. ServiceNow enables service management for every department in the enterprise including IT, human resources, facilities, field service and more.
